为了账号安全,请及时绑定邮箱和手机立即绑定

不是说操作session要开启事务么,为什么这段查询代码不用开启和关闭事务,直接就能使用

不是说操作session要开启事务么,为什么这段查询代码不用开启和关闭事务,直接就能使用



正在回答

2 回答

当save,delete,update时,需要事务。get和load貌似不需要。

0 回复 有任何疑惑可以回复我~
#1

火星葱 提问者

非常感谢!
2015-11-06 回复 有任何疑惑可以回复我~

是这样吗?

0 回复 有任何疑惑可以回复我~
#1

拿馒头盖房子

不是这么理解的 将实例化对象有瞬时态/持久态/托管态进行转换时需要开启事务, 不是三者转换不需要,例如get方法就是
2016-09-07 回复 有任何疑惑可以回复我~
#2

qq_絵空事_1

回想之前的学习,开启事务是为了防止数据的错误或者丢失,而查询操作并不会对数据进行什么更改,所以没必要开启事务吧?
2018-02-28 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消
Hibernate初探之一对多映射
  • 参与学习       42171    人
  • 解答问题       295    个

Hibernate中一对多关联映射配置,以及cascade和inverse属性作用

进入课程

不是说操作session要开启事务么,为什么这段查询代码不用开启和关闭事务,直接就能使用

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信